MIRO Industries is hiring a full-time Custom Builder, in our Heber City, Utah, warehouse. This position works 40 hours per week, Monday – Friday, approximately 7:30 a.m. – 4:00 p.m. You get a set schedule, keeping your nights and weekends free, and holidays off!
Pay starts at $16.50+ hour, depending on experience. As a full-time MIRO employee, you are eligible for our comprehensive benefit package, including 100%-company-paid health insurance, health savings account with a generous company contribution, paid holidays, paid time off, SIMPLE IRA with employer match, long-term disability and life insurance, quarterly profit sharing, and a great work culture!
As a Builder in MIRO’s Custom department, you are part of a team that assembles and builds custom roof supports with metal struts and bracketing. Prior experience is not necessary. You will receive on-the-job training to read blueprints and to pack and ship jobs according to MIRO’s specifications. You are expected to learn various aspects of job building and product application. MIRO places high priority on safety and lean production and this position is expected to be fully engaged with implementing safe practices and helping the warehouse reach its lean (also called 5S) goals.
From time to time, you may be expected to help in other areas as needed and directed by your supervisor.
As a builder, you are expected to:
- Know how to use a tape measure,
- Be able to add and subtract fractions,
- Be comfortable using power tools.
A builder also needs to:
- Be willing and able to work in teams (usually teams of 2 – 3 people),
- Be willing to take advice and make suggestions for improvement,
- Be flexible,
- Be on feet all day on a concrete floor,
- Lift 50 – 60 lbs. continuously throughout the day,
- Be tolerant of temperature swings (the warehouse is hot in summer and cold in winter),
- Keep work area clean and neat and organized according to 5S principles.

MIRO Industries is hiring a full-time Assembler, in our Heber City, Utah, warehouse. This position works 40 hours per week, Monday – Friday. There are two different shift possibilities: one is the day shift, approximately 7:30 a.m. – 4:00 p.m.; the other is the swing shift, working 2:00 p.m. – 10:30 p.m. You get a set schedule, keeping your weekends free, and holidays off!
Pay starts at $16.50+ hour, depending on experience. As a full-time MIRO employee, you are eligible for our comprehensive benefit package, including 100%-company-paid health insurance, health savings account with a generous company contribution, paid holidays, paid time off, SIMPLE IRA with employer match, long-term disability and life insurance, quarterly profit sharing, and a great work culture!
If hired as an Assembler, you will receive training on how to read part schematics and to pack jobs for shipment for multiple assembly products. MIRO places high priority on safety and you are expected to be fully engaged with implementing safe practices and helping the warehouse reach its Lean goals.
From time to time, you may be expected to help in other areas as directed by your manager.
As an assembler, you are expected to:
- Know how to use a tape measure,
- Be comfortable using power tools,
- Have good eye-hand coordination,
- Have basic math skills, including add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division.
An assembler also needs to:
- Be able to do repetitive work for long periods of time,
- Be aware of and maintain supply levels for job you are currently working on,
- Be willing to learn, and willing to make suggestions for improvement,
- Be on feet all day on a concrete floor,
- Lift 20 – 30 lbs. several times a day,
- Work to MIRO safety standards,
- Be tolerant of temperature swings (the warehouse is hot in summer and cool in winter),
- Keep work area clean, neat, and organized according to Lean principles.
